Evgeniya Maksimovna Rudneva was born on December 24 1920. Her birthplace was Berdyansk. She died April 9 1944 in Kerch. She was a Soviet Guards Senior Lieutenant. Rudneva was also a navigator. She earned the title of Hero of the Soviet Union.

Evgeniya Maksimovna Rudneva’s life is one of remarkable dedication. She showed excellence in her studies. This later propelled her into the world of aviation.

In school Evgeniya was the secretary of the Komsomol organization. From the 9th grade she was engaged in the astronomical circle. Soon she had a firm desire to be an astronomer. In 1938 Zhenya graduated from secondary school. She then entered the Faculty of Mechanics and Mathematics at Moscow State University.

Evgeniya Rudneva simultaneously worked in the Department of the Sun. In 1939 her first scientific article was published in the journal “Bulletin of VAGO”. It was titled “Biological Observations During the Solar Eclipse of June 19 1936”.

World War II changed everything. Rudneva’s passion was astronomy. However she decided to join the military to defend her country.

In October 1941 Zhenya Rudneva joined the women’s aviation regiment. Hero of the Soviet Union Marina Raskova selected her. Rudneva’s good math skills helped her master the job.

From May 1942 Evgeniya Rudneva fought on various fronts. These included the Transcaucasian and Ukrainian fronts. She served with the 46th Guards Night Bomber Aviation Regiment.

Rudneva participated in battles. These battles were in the Northern Caucasus. She also fought in Taman and Kerch. She was a skilled navigator.

By the time of her death Guards Senior Lieutenant E. M. Rudneva had completed 645 night sorties. These sorties targeted enemy troops. She also aimed at railway echelons.

On the night of April 9 1944 Zhenya Rudneva died. She was on a combat mission near Kerch.

For her bravery Evgeniya Maksimovna Rudneva posthumously received the title of Hero of the Soviet Union. She also received other awards.

Today Evgeniya Maksimovna Rudneva’s memory lives on. A monument stands in the territory of the Saltykovskaya Gymnasium. There is also a memorial plaque on a street. A school in Kerch bears her name. Even one of the newly discovered small planets has been named “Rudneva”.
